Whispers of the Sea: Unveiling the Enchantment of Port Townsend

Port Townsend, Washington, is a charming coastal gem nestled on the shores of Puget Sound. Known for its Victorian architecture and vibrant arts scene, this walkable port town invites exploration at every turn. Stroll along the waterfront, visit the historic Fort Worden, and take in breathtaking views of the Olympic Mountains. With its eclectic shops, delicious seafood restaurants, and welcoming community, Port Townsend offers a perfect blend of relaxation and adventure. Whether you're seeking a romantic getaway or a cultural escape, this enchanting destination promises unforgettable experiences amidst stunning natural landscapes. Things to do in Port Townsend for first time

Port Townsend offers a perfect three-day escape for travelers seeking natural beauty and adventure. With stunning beaches, lush forests, and majestic mountains, visitors can enjoy boating, sailing, and hiking. The charming coastal atmosphere, along with opportunities for camping and shopping, makes it a must-visit destination on Puget Sound. Here's a quick itinerary to make the most of your trip to Port Townsend:

  • Day 1: Begin your adventure at Fort Casey State Park, where you can explore the historic coastal fortifications and enjoy breathtaking views of the Puget Sound. Afterward, take a leisurely stroll around Fort Casey, immersing yourself in the rich military history and scenic landscapes. Don't forget to check out Crockett Lake, a serene spot perfect for birdwatching and picnicking. This tranquil area offers a wonderful opportunity to unwind and enjoy the natural beauty surrounding you.
  • Day 2: Start your exploration at Fort Flagler State Park, which features stunning beaches and hiking trails. As you traverse the park, be sure to visit the iconic Marrowstone Point Lighthouse, a picturesque spot with a rich maritime history. Conclude your day at Mystery Bay State Park, where you can walk along the shoreline and enjoy the peaceful ambiance. This hidden gem is perfect for a relaxing evening as the sun sets over the bay.
  • Day 3: Kick off your day at Ebey's Landing National Historical Reserve, where you can hike along scenic trails that offer panoramic views of the coastline and lush landscapes. Next, head to Fort Ebey State Park, known for its rugged cliffs and historical significance. Cap off your day at Coupeville Wharf, where you can enjoy charming shops, local eateries, and stunning waterfront views, making it a perfect spot to reflect on your memorable trip.

Best time to go to Port Townsend

Port Townsend experiences its lowest average temperature in December, at 40.3°F (4.6°C), while August is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 62.2°F (16.8°C). November tends to be the wettest month. The peak travel months to visit Port Townsend are June to August, which see a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, accompanied by dry to light rainfall. In contrast, January, November, and December are ideal if you're looking for a calmer vacation, marked by light rainfall and mostly cloudy conditions.

Spend time at the beach, as well as appreciating the historic sites, checking out the local cuisine, and visiting the port in Port Townsend. Nature lovers can visit Kah Tai Lagoon Nature Park and Anderson Lake State Park. And while you're here, be sure to stop by Rose Theatre and Ann Starrett Mansion.
